Arsenal Transfer News: Nico Williams Emerges as Arteta’s Dream Signing

Arsenal’s season has carried both promise and tension, a campaign that has flirted with greatness while exposing the fragility of fine margins. According to TEAMtalk, the club are now preparing a decisive move to sign Nico Williams, a player described as “one of Europe’s best wingers”, in what could become a defining transfer of Mikel Arteta’s tenure.

Williams Profile Fits Arsenal Vision

Williams represents more than a tactical tweak. At 23, he combines elite pace with a directness that Arsenal have occasionally lacked. His decision last summer to remain at Athletic Club, committing to a 10 year deal, raised his release clause from €60m to €90m, yet it has not deterred interest.

The report notes that Arsenal are considering meeting that fee, underlining how highly Arteta rates him as a “dream signing”. Behind the scenes, sporting director Andrea Berta is pushing to make the deal viable, while the player himself is said to be open to a move after frustration with a lack of progression in Bilbao.

This is not simply opportunism, it is strategy.

Squad Evolution Signals Change

Any arrival of this magnitude would reshape the squad. The suggestion that Gabriel Martinelli and Gabriel Jesus could be moved on hints at a recalibration of Arsenal’s attacking identity.

Last summer brought investment in Noni Madueke, Eberechi Eze, and Viktor Gyokeres, a trio intended to elevate the attack. It has worked in phases, but consistency has eluded them.

Arsenal can dominate games, control tempo, and dictate space, yet too often they struggle to deliver the decisive moment that defines champions.

Williams offers precisely that. A player capable of unsettling defences, stretching structure, and forcing chaos where control has failed.
